Transaction 20e04537d94a7b2b2808987ffd15813161aac2bd189eb8264e33659ae4895826
2 Input
2 Outputs
- 20e04537d94a7b2b2808987ffd15813161aac2bd189eb8264e33659ae4895826:0
- 20e04537d94a7b2b2808987ffd15813161aac2bd189eb8264e33659ae4895826:1
value 312322
address 1KJftnUaTE6Ni2rpNANtnCPAdft3qhDNhM
value 1471216
address 3FysPzYkfQBQfW7vXkkY8uJwVyMdasZNXk